​     Lemoore Naval Air Station

Picture


​Naval Air Station Lemoore is located in Kings County and Fresno County, California.  Lemoore is the Navy's newest and largest Master Jet Base. Strike Fighter Wing Pacific, along with its associated squadrons, call this home.

Picture
See below for thousands of pages documenting contamination at Lemoore dating back to 1991. Many of the most sensitive records are not available without filing a lengthy and costly Freedom of Information Act Request, (FOIA).    
 
Lemoore Naval Air Station 

Picture
 
 Lemoore is identified as a DOD installation with known or suspected releases of PFOS/PFOA, according to a DOD Report to Congress on Aqueous Film-Forming Foam - Nov. 3, 2017.

No testing results were made public regarding the base, only that it is likely contaminated with the ”forever chemicals.”

Lemoore Naval Air Station - Source - DOD

CONTAMINATED GROUNDWATER

1,1,1-Trichloroethane 5600.0 ppb 
1,1,2-Trichloroethane 12000.0 ppb 
1,1-Dichloroethane 3800.0 ppb 
1,1-Dichloroethylene 230000.0 ppb 
1,2-Dichlorobenzene 32000.0 ppb 
1,2-Dichloroethane (EDC) 7000.0 ppb 
1,4-Dichlorobenzene 2700.0 ppb 
Acetone 28000.0 ppb 
Aluminum 11700000.0 ppb 
Antimony and compounds 1010000.0 ppb 
Arsenic (cancer) 20000.0 ppb 
Barium and compounds 111000.0 ppb 
Benzene 12000000.0 ppb 
Beryllium and compounds 5000.0 ppb 
Bis(2-ethylhexyl)phthalate (DEHP) 120000.0 ppb 
Bromodichloromethane 6600.0 ppb 
Bromoform (tribromomethane) 5000.0 ppb 
Butyl benzyl phthalate 3000.0 ppb 
Cadmium and compounds 25000.0 ppb 
Chloroform 7200.0 ppb 
Copper and compounds 33100.0 ppb 
Dibromochloromethane 6000.0 ppb 
Diethyl phthalate 7000.0 ppb 
Dimethyl phthalate 4000.0 ppb 
Fluoride 230000.0 ppb 
Iron 15800000.0 ppb
Lead 20000.0 ppb 
Manganese and compounds 433000.0 ppb 
Mercury and compounds (inorganic) 200.0 ppb 
Methylene chloride 18000.0 ppb 
Molybdenum 374000.0 ppb 
MTBE 130000000.0 ppb 
Nickel and compounds 70000.0 ppb 
Nitrate 15000000.0 ppb 
Phenol 22000.0 ppb 
Selenium 281000.0 ppb 
Silver and compounds 20000.0 ppb 
Tetrachloroethylene (PCE) 2100.0 ppb 
Toluene 390.0 ppb Ethylbenzene 400.0 ppb 
Trichloroethylene (TCE) 5300000.0 ppb 
Vanadium 33000.0 ppb 
Xylene, o- 750.0 ppb Xylene (mixed) 1410.0 ppb 
Zinc 129000.0 ppb

Lemoore Naval Air Station  Serves: 11,500  Data available: 2012—2017  Source: Surface water
https://www.ewg.org/tapwater/system.php?pws=CA1610700 
Contaminants Detected 10 EXCEED EWG HEALTH GUIDELINES

19 Total Contaminants

EWG's drinking water quality report shows results of tests conducted by the water utility and provided to the Environmental Working Group by the California State Water Resources Control Board, as well as information from the U.S. EPA Enforcement and Compliance History database (ECHO). For the latest quarter assessed by the U.S. EPA (January 2019 - March 2019), tap water provided by this water utility was in compliance with federal health-based drinking water standards.

Legal does not necessarily equal safe. Getting a passing grade from the federal government does not mean the water meets the latest health guidelines.
Legal limits for contaminants in tap water have not been updated in almost 20 years.
The best way to ensure clean tap water is to keep pollution out of source water in the first place.

Picture



​    The California Water Board did not test Lemoore's water for PFOS/PFOA in 2019.
